Latest Patents

Among his latest patents, Ikeda has developed a process for producing a gel-like composition of a high polymer. This process involves molding an acetylene high polymer by press-forming a gel-like composition that consists of 5 to 95% by weight of an acetylene high polymer with a fibril structure and 95 to 5% by weight of an organic solvent. Additionally, he has patented a process for producing an electrically conductive high polymer of acetylene. This invention relates to creating an organic semiconductor by doping an acetylene high polymer with a specified electron acceptor compound. The resulting electrically conductive acetylene high polymer exhibits increased electrical conductivity, flexibility, and heat stability, making it suitable for applications in photoelectric converter elements such as solar cells and photosensors.
